Chlordiazepoxide Hydrochloride And Clidinium Bromide is iNDICATIONS AND USAGEBased on a review of this drug by the National Academy of Sciences – National Research Council and/or other information, FDA has classified the indications as follows:"Possibly" effective: as adjunctive therapy in the treatment of peptic ulcer and in the treatment of the irritable bowel syndrome (irritable colon, spastic colon, mucous colitis) and acute enterocolitis.Final classification of the less-than-effective indications required further investigation. The NDC Directory contains ONLY information on final marketed drugs submitted to FDA electronically by labelers. A labeler might be a manufacturer, re-packager or re-labeler. The product information included in the NDC directory does not indicate that FDA has verified the information provided by the product labeler. Assigned NDC numbers are not in any way an indication of FDA approval of the product.
